John Hermsen:
> Hi,
>
> I do have mysql installed, but when I use postfix -m it doesn't mention
> mysql.
The installed version of Postfix has no mysql support.
> When I use the dict_open program which is made at compilation I am able to
> get aliases from mysql. Why does this work and not postfix itself, I'm sure
> I compiled it correctly and with configure it did find the mysql library and
> mysql.h?
You need to install the Postfix that does have mysql support.
See the INSTALL file.
